Aracılığıyla paylaş


ConnectionInfos.Item Özelliği

Alır ConnectionInfo gelen nesne koleksiyon adı, dizin, kimliği veya kimlik.

Ad Alanı:  Microsoft.SqlServer.Dts.Runtime
Derleme:  Microsoft.SqlServer.ManagedDTS (Microsoft.SqlServer.ManagedDTS içinde.dll)

Sözdizimi

'Bildirim
Public ReadOnly Default Property Item ( _
    index As Object _
) As ConnectionInfo
    Get
'Kullanım
Dim instance As ConnectionInfos
Dim index As Object
Dim value As ConnectionInfo

value = instance(index)
public ConnectionInfo this[
    Object index
] { get; }
public:
property ConnectionInfo^ default[Object^ index] {
    ConnectionInfo^ get (Object^ index);
}
member Item : ConnectionInfo
JScript, dizinli özelliklerin kullanılmasını destekler, ancak yenilerinin bildirilmesini desteklemez.

Parametreler

  • index
    Tür: System.Object
    Adı, dizin, kimliği veya koleksiyon nesnesinin kimliği dönün.

Özellik Değeri

Tür: Microsoft.SqlServer.Dts.Runtime.ConnectionInfo
A ConnectionInfo gelen nesne koleksiyon adı, dizin, kimliği veya verilen kimlik eşleşen index parametresi.

Açıklamalar

Çağrı, Contains yöntem döndürür doğru, belirtilen öğe erişebilirsiniz koleksiyon sözdizimini kullanarak ConnectionInfos[index].Contains yöntem döndürür yanlış, bu özellik bir istisna atar.C# ile dizinleyici için bu özellik olan ConnectionInfos WalkTree

Örnekler

Aşağıdaki kod örneği, öğe alır koleksiyon iki yöntemi kullanarak.İlk yöntem kullanır connectionInfos[0] tüm nesneyi almak için sözdizimi ilk konumda bulunan koleksiyon içine yerleştirir ve connInfo nesne.Şimdi tüm özelliklerini al ConnectionInfo her zamanki gibi nesne.İkinci yöntem ilk nesne, belirli bir özellik alır koleksiyon.

using System;
using System.Collections.Generic;
using System.Text;
using Microsoft.SqlServer.Dts.Runtime;

namespace ConnectionInfos_GetEnum
{
    class Program
    {
        static void Main(string[] args)
        {
            Application dtsApplication = new Application();
            ConnectionInfos connectionInfos = dtsApplication.ConnectionInfos;

            //Using the Item method syntax of [x], obtain the first entry and a name.
            ConnectionInfo connInfo = connectionInfos[0];
            String nameOfFirstItem = connectionInfos[0].Name;

            //Print the name of the log provider object located at position [0].
            Console.WriteLine("The ID of the first connection info is: {0}", connInfo.ID);
            Console.WriteLine("The Name of the first connection info is: {0}", nameOfFirstItem);

        }
    }
}
Imports System
Imports System.Collections.Generic
Imports System.Text
Imports Microsoft.SqlServer.Dts.Runtime
 
Namespace ConnectionInfos_GetEnum
    Class Program
        Shared  Sub Main(ByVal args() As String)
            Dim dtsApplication As Application =  New Application() 
            Dim connectionInfos As ConnectionInfos =  dtsApplication.ConnectionInfos 
 
            'Using the Item method syntax of [x], obtain the first entry and a name.
            Dim connInfo As ConnectionInfo =  connectionInfos(0) 
            Dim nameOfFirstItem As String =  connectionInfos(0).Name 
 
            'Print the name of the log provider object located at position [0].
            Console.WriteLine("The ID of the first connection info is: {0}", connInfo.ID)
            Console.WriteLine("The Name of the first connection info is: {0}", nameOfFirstItem)
 
        End Sub
    End Class
End Namespace

Örnek Çıktı:

The ID of the first connection info is: {41F5EFE4-E91A-4EB0-BF10-D40FD48B3C03}

The Name of the first connection info is: DTS Connection Manager for Files